About Cármen Ferreira
Cármen Ferreira is a scholar working on Soil Science, Earth-Surface Processes and Management, Monitoring, Policy and Law, having authored 10 papers that have together received 368 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Soil erosion and sediment transport (3 papers), Aeolian processes and effects (2 papers) and Fire effects on ecosystems (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Global and Planetary Change (309 citations), Safety, Risk, Reliability and Quality (97 citations) and Management, Monitoring, Policy and Law (79 citations). Cármen Ferreira has collaborated with scholars based in Portugal, Brazil and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Joana Parente, Malik Amraoui, Douglas Paton, Mário Pereira, Tara Renae McGee, Luís Mário Ribeiro, Michael R. Coughlan, Fantina Tedim, Vittorio Leone and Paulo M. Fernandes.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Genes Chromosomes and Cancer and Die Naturwissenschaften.
